Two Good Examples of Leadership

This coming Saturday in Dallas, Texas is one of the big games in the college football season. It is a rivalry game known commonly as the Red River Shootout (or the Red River Rivalry) that takes place annually between the University of Oklahoma Sooners and the University of Texas Longhorns. It is one of college footballs biggest rivalry games and one that is a bitter rivalry between the two schools.

In the midst of all this, stands two quarterbacks: OU redshirt junior QB Sam Bradford and UT redshirt senior QB Colt McCoy. Both QBs are highly touted with many school records and accolades including a Heisman Trophy for Bradford. They are considered high draft picks in next year's NFL draft.

They are also strong followers of Jesus. In many interviews both large and small, they have made clear their faith and their walk with Christ. It is something that is really refreshing to hear from young men in positions such as these who excel in athletics but are also looking to grow deeper in their walk with Christ at a young age.

Baptist Press Sports recently had an article on an interview they did with McCoy talking about his recent trips to Peru with Fellowship of Christian Athletes. While he was there traveling to various villages helping to build homes, teaching various sports and sharing the gospel, it left an indellible mark. You can read more of the article here.
